Full Description
A WWII emergency water supply visible on aerial photography taken in 1946 [1], located in St Margaret’s at Cliffe. The circular structure was 11m in diameter, with walls 1m thick. Unusually this feature had exterior banking of a 3.5m thickness. The structure was absent on aerial photographs taken in 1949 [2], but was visible on Next Perspectives photography taken in 2003 and 2007 [3, 4] as a parch mark.
A transcription of the feature recorded from aerial photography exists within a GIS layer held by this HER.
